What is a complete sentence?

Back

A complete sentence is a group of words that expresses a complete thought and includes a subject and a predicate.

What is a fragment?

Back

A fragment is a group of words that does not express a complete thought and is often missing a subject or a predicate.

What does a subject do in a sentence?

Back

The subject tells us who or what the sentence is about.

What does a predicate do in a sentence?

Back

The predicate tells us what the subject does or is.
